Der Euro: Aspekte der Umsetzung für den Verbraucher

The euro: Aspects of implementation for consumers

Heinz Handler and Edith Frauwallner

MPRA Paper from University Library of Munich, Germany

Abstract: The present collection of essays and opinions is devoted to the introduction of the euro in Austria at the beginning of 1999, with particular emphasis on the consequences for consumers. In general, the single currency is expected to lower transaction costs and dampen price developments. However, in production areas with pent-up cost increases suppliers may use the occasion to adjust price levels upwards. The current publication contributes to informing the general public and thereby to securing confidence in the new currency.
